Unscramble SEWTRERHCATSAE

Above is the result of unscrambling sewtrerhcatsae.

Unscrambled words using the letters sewtrerhcatsae is weathercasters and more anagrams containing the letters sewtrerhcatsae.

Listed max. 50 anagram words.